Hi Reinald,
> Are there different Versions of Epox Presenter BT-PM01B and can
> the latest one be used with kernel 2.4 ?
>
> The device I bought recently
> - is hdi-based
> - has to be brought to "pairing mode" by pressing 3 buttons
> after poweron in order to react to hcitool scan.
>
> (Both facts are not mentioned in
> http://www.holtmann.org/linux/bluetooth/epox.html)
>
> epox-presenter: "no devices in range"
> epox-presenter <hw_addr>: "socket:connection refused"
>
>
> The BT-PM01B works great on linux 2.6.10 using hidd --server.
> I have one 2.4.29 - System however I can not upgrade yet.
apply one of my -mh patches for that kernel.
